Output 8882556563828d58a1c8d10f093def8dba6d1857852869684bf01f61862f0b00:1

value
6942566801383
script pubkey
OP_0 OP_PUSHBYTES_20 ed3afac2e5edbea7fdd8f79d59fc49ae85a7fe7e
address
tb1qa5a04sh9akl20lwc77w4nlzf46z60ln7rmkqwa
transaction
8882556563828d58a1c8d10f093def8dba6d1857852869684bf01f61862f0b00
spent
true